1. Purpose
To codify the League's absolute and non-negotiable position that no cetacean is ever taken into captivity, and to define how resident pods are tracked and defended. The procedure guarantees that marine mammals are never captured, held, or transported under any circumstance, that pods are monitored only by non-invasive means, and that any deliberate harm to a pod escalates straight to dossier opening.

3. Definitions
| Term | Definition |
|---|
| Non-Captivity Absolute | The unconditional rule that no cetacean is ever captured, held, or transported — without exception. |
| Photo-ID | Identification of individual animals by natural markings, used for non-invasive pod tracking. |
| Drive-Hunt | The herding of cetaceans into a confined kill or capture zone, a primary interdiction trigger. |
| Resident Pod | A tracked marine-mammal group within a defended range, monitored by photo-ID and acoustic tag. |

5. Pod Defence Response Matrix
| Situation | Permitted Action | Prohibited Action | Escalation |
|---|
| Routine pod tracking | Photo-ID, acoustic tag | Any capture or restraint | None |
| Entanglement / stranding | Aid under vet direction | Captive holding | Field report |
| Illegal whaling detected | Interdict via AE-SOP-0320 | Boarding for capture | Dossier opening |
| Drive-hunt in progress | Disrupt the drive | Taking any animal aboard | Direct-Action referral |
Note. No situation — not rescue, not defence, not transport — ever justifies taking a cetacean into captivity; the absolute holds without exception.

7. Procedure
7.1 Tracking
- Track and defend resident pods by photo-ID and acoustic tag only.
- Never capture, hold, or transport any cetacean — without exception.
- Maintain the photo-ID catalogue current for each resident pod.
7.2 Defence
- Use pod movements to flag illegal whaling and drive-hunts for interdiction.
- Disrupt drive-hunts and whaling under AE-SOP-0320, never by taking an animal aboard.
- Escalate any deliberate harm to a pod straight to dossier opening.
7.3 Aid
- Render aid to entangled or stranded animals under veterinary direction.
- Free and release in place — never into captivity.
- File a field report on every aid intervention.
